Very Safe Mail is a System extension that places an additional menu on
your Macintosh menu bar. The menu commands can be used with almost all
e-mail applications, including Claris Emailer, Eudora, and Netscape
Navigator, to encrypt (or decrypt) both e-mail messages and attached
data files.

When you encrypt a message addressed to your correspondent, Very Safe
Mail uses your secret key to encode the message and affix your
?signature? to the message. Encryption both locks up the message and
makes the message illegible to anyone who does not have a copy of your
public key. The signature provides additional proof to your
correspondent that the message actually originated from you, and not
from someone else who may have counterfeited your e-mail address.

When you send the message to your correspondent, they will use Very
Safe Mail (and their copy of your public key) to both decrypt the
message and to verify the signature. Two dialog boxes appear during
the decryption process, to inform them that the message text can be
decrypted as they do have the right key, and that the message actually
came from you.
